How Does Scientific Notation Work?
In scientific notation, numbers are written in the form \( a \times 10^b \). Here, \( a \) is a number between 1 and 10, and \( b \) is an integer that tells us the power of ten to multiply by. This method allows for clear comparison and calculations involving numbers of varying sizes. Some examples include:
- 3,500,000 becomes \( 3.5 \times 10^6 \)
- 0.0042 turns into \( 4.2 \times 10^{-3} \)

The Importance of Scientific Notation
Scientific notation is widely used in fields like Science and engineering. It simplifies working with extremely large or small numbers, such as the distance between stars or the size of atoms. By standardising how we write these numbers, it makes them easier to read, compare, and calculate. Here are some key uses:
- Simplifies large numbers for easy comprehension
- Clarifies the size of tiny measurements
- Improves accuracy in calculations with very different magnitudes
